WebSkills and techniques: recipes with skill levels The range of savoury and sweet dishes in this topic pack covers all the skills and techniques outlined in section D of the specification. The dishes are categorised into high, medium and low skill levels. With this knowledge, we can … chiropractor pearland txWebStudents’ dishes should show different, not repetitive, making skills. The dishes they select should reflect the research findings. Students can make both savoury and sweet dishes. This is an excellent opportunity to experiment, be creative and showcase students’ food preparation/technical skills.
